GERMANY UPDATE : LIVE in the Press Centre and NDR officially confirm the Winner of Eurovision Selection
Thanks to our colleagues and friend at ESC Insight – Mr Thomas Schreiber of NDR has taken to the stage to talk of the events tonight at the German National Selection for Eurovision 2015.
After Andreas Kümmert was declared the winner he then declined the offer LIVE on stage. The unfamiliar territory then say Ann Sophie being asked if she would take his place in Vienna. Confusion was awash in the stadium.
Now in the press conference room Mr Thomas Schreiber of NDR has taken to the stage and has confirmed that Ann Sophie will represent Germany at Eurovision 2015 in Vienna with her song ‘Black Smoke’.
Thus ends a night of excitement in Germany and for the second year in a row the Wild Card entrant has won the German Nation Final for Eurovision.
